Explain how the statement "there is 3/4 cup per serving" represents a rate.
Aleonysh [2.5K]
There is 3/4 cup of whatever in one serving. If that serving amount changed to 2, then the 3/4 would be multiplied by 2. If there is half a serving, then it would be divided by 2. There is a constant change, and not one that is always changing.
